Location:Leeds (Hybrid – 2 days/week)

Compensation:Up to £55,000 (plus benefits)


Are you a hands-on data engineer ready to modernize a legacy environment and leave a lasting impact?


We're partnered with a growing financial services firm undergoing a full data transformation—this is your chance to get in early and help build something from the ground up. Backed by senior leadership and driven by a clear vision, the business is shifting from fragmented BI reporting to a modern, cloud-native data function.

You won’t just be building pipelines—you’ll be helping to define how the business uses data for the next decade.


What You’ll Be Doing

  • Designing and developing data pipelines as part of a migration toMicrosoft Fabric.
  • Moving legacy systems (SQL, SSRS, ClickView) into a scalable, governed data platform.
  • Working alongside Data Governance and Insights teams to embed quality at the source.
  • Supporting the shift to self-service analytics and reducing operational reporting bottlenecks.
  • Playing a key role in transforming a reactive BI setup into a proactive data function.


What We’re Looking For

  • Strong SQL and data warehousing fundamentals.
  • Experience with cloud data toolsMicrosoft Fabricis must.
  • Exposure to BI/reporting tools like Power BI, SSRS, or similar.
  • Comfortable in a hybrid environment (2 days/week in Leeds).
  • Someone who thrives in transformation projects and wants to make their mark.


Why Join?

  • Work directly under a Head of Data with full C-suite support.
  • Influence strategic tech decisions—this is not business-as-usual.
  • Small but growing team = fast learning, fast impact.
  • Long-term vision focused on building internal capability

The Ultimate Assessment-Centre Survival Guide for Data Science Jobs in the UK

Assessment centres for data science positions in the UK are designed to replicate the multifaceted challenges of real-world analytics teams. Employers combine psychometric assessments, coding tests, statistical reasoning exercises, group case studies and behavioural interviews to see how you interpret data, build models, communicate insights and collaborate under pressure.
